A patient is going to be prescribed bifocals which will be 2.50 cm from the eye. The prescribed powers (in diopters) for the bifocals are +1.60 and -0.40, and these bifocals give the patient normal vision.
(a) Without the bifocals, what is the patient's near point?
cm
(b) Without the bifocals, what is the patient's far point?
